函數的定義和使用
在C語言中,函數由函數頭和函數體兩部分組成。函數頭包含函數名、參數列表和返回值類型,函數體則是一系列實現特定功能的語句。
函數的定義格式如下
返回值類型 函數名(參數列表)
//函數體
其中,返回值類型可以是任意基本數據類型或自定義的數據類型,函數名是函數的名稱,參數列表指定了函數需要的輸入參數和其類型。
函數的使用流程如下
1.在程序中聲明函數,即在函數調用之前,需要在代碼的開頭加上函數的聲明語句。
2.在程序中調用函數,即在程序的任何地方使用函數名,傳遞參數并執行函數體中的語句。
3.函數執行完畢后,返回執行結果。
舉個例子,下面是一個簡單的函數,用于求兩個整數的和
ttt b)
{ a + b;
在主函數中調用該函數,可以這樣寫
tain()
{t a = 10, b = 20;t = add(a, b);tf); 0;
= 30。
通過上述例子,我們可以看到,函數的定義和使用非常簡單,只需要注意函數名、參數列表和返回值類型的設置即可。使用函數可以提高程序的可讀性和可維護性,也可以避免代碼的重復,提高代碼的復用率。